Perhaps the innovation we are most interested in is our new food.
The safe flexible packaging materials we introduced at the packaging Expo.
The material is designed for the entire range of TrojanLabel printers.
This breakthrough technology uses the unique ultra-thin polyester film specially developed to accept our waterbased inks.
The reason why this technology is so notable is because it is used in a wide range of packaging applications for our TrojanLabel printer, especially in fast-
The growing market for food, medicine and medicine.
More and more industries are transforming into flexible packaging to reduce material costs, reduce waste, increase consumer convenience and enhance brand difference.
Our TrojanLabel team is excited and we now have the way to get into this dynamic market.
Steering test and measurement part.
Third-quarter revenue rose 51% from the same period in fiscal 2018.
Our aerospace business is the main driver of this growth, reflecting the contribution of our cockpit printers, supplies and network systems.
Our data collection products have also experienced strong growth, especially the new Daxus and DDX product lines.
As a result, during the second quarter conference call in August, we continued to make steady progress in integration of Honeywell\'s aviation printer product line.
As I mentioned, with production now fully integrated in West Warwick, the final clean-up part of the transition relates to the direct transfer of many individual and client contracts to astoniva.
At the end of October, we managed to transition several larger contracts.
As more and more contracts are transferred to us, we are able to improve our responsiveness and profitability.
However, at the current pace, it is still expected to take several quarters to complete all tasks.
